If one gets to know the Vajra family of Barolo, the first thing one can immediately perceive about them is their deep commitment and love for their land, the tradition they carry and the respect with which they bring it to today. It is therefore no surprise that they embrace and bring to the market one of the rarest and most special products of the Langhe. It is Barolo Chinato, a wine flavoured with herbs and fortified, a local speciality of the region. Since Barolo is used as the base wine for its production, this style is part of the DOCG designation of origin and is one of the most traditional, albeit rare, products. The base for Vajra's Chinato is their stunning Barolo Albe which is infused with a recipe of many herbs and spices to give a digestive that is explosive in character with aromas of rose, ripe cherries, mountain herbs, and orange zest, with a palate that combines bitterness and sweetness together and an extremely persistent finish.

If you dig a little deeper into the history of Barolo you will see that things are different from the picture we have today. For example, the first dry wines of the region only started to be produced around 1830-1840 AD, at the encouragement of the last Marquise of Barolo Giulia Falletti, and before this milestone the wines were sweet. Thus Chinato is one of the traditional landmarks of Barolo, a product that revives the atmosphere of the 18th century pharmacies in the area. Wine, as in many other regions of the world, had medicinal properties at that time and was very often the product of blending with various herbs, roots, spices and other ingredients. This tradition continues to this day and indeed for Vajra's Chinato over 30 ingredients are used to flavour the Barolo, and the process is completed with organic oranges from Sicily along with spices and brown sugar.
